      At the heart of the narrative is Amy Feldman, who, feeling trapped in a stagnant marriage to her indifferent husband, Josh, embarks on a transformative journey inspired by President Obama's inauguration. Leaving her law career behind, she immerses herself in social justice in Chicago, creating tension in her family relationships. As Amy discovers new love and purpose, Josh faces the reality of their crumbling marriage and must decide whether to fight for their connection. The story explores themes of love, ambition, and the struggle for personal fulfillment.

      A Jewish-American family saga unfolds around the rise of a fashion retail empire and the ensuing devastation within the family. Josh Feldman, son of Max Feldman, the ambitious founder of the successful shoe store chain Fratelli Massimo, has always envisioned his future working alongside his father. Starting with a single store in the 1950s, financed by his mother’s trust fund, Max capitalizes on the shopping mall boom, expanding the St. Louis-based business to hundreds of locations nationwide. At industry events, he is a celebrated figure, admired by suppliers and the media. Eager to follow in his father’s footsteps, Josh is passionate about the family business, distinguishing himself from his charismatic brother and sophisticated mother, who is more focused on literature and family life. As Josh matures and begins his own family while climbing the corporate ladder, he gradually uncovers his father's treacherous nature. Max's ruthless ambition and desire for recognition raise questions about whether Josh will ever truly inherit the business. When the family becomes divided over its future, Josh confronts the harsh reality that his father's promises may have surpassed their expiration date.
